The Customer Service Associate will assist customers with any troubles or inquiries that they might have. A customer service associate must possess a service-oriented attitude, as well as a friendly and personable attitude. This is a full-time position in Troy, MI.

Hours: Monday - Friday 8:30 am - 5:00 pm EST (some overtime by be required)

Job Duties and Responsibilities

Duties include but are not limited to:
  • Coordinate with customers to resolve any billing inquiries.
  • Act as the first point of contact for customers seeking help with products or technical issues.
  • Provide troubleshooting and technical assistance to customers.
  • Assess the customer's needs and translate into solutions.
  • Ability to understand and explain a customer's account balance and to provide the means for them to make any necessary changes to their payment processes
  • Can understand and explain the processes of the Homeowners Association to a customer.
  • Calmly assist customers in emergency situations by coordinating contact to other personnel and vendors.
  • Assist vendors with invoices and other questions
  • Ability to utilize the Associa website from both Homeowners and Community Archives sides.
  • To make necessary changes to Association Facts in proprietary database when updates are necessary to ensure information is accurate
  • Must have prior customer service experience and be able to handle stress.
  • Other duties as assigned.
